36 CFR Part 1191 ADA and ABA Accessibility Guidelines for Emergency Transportable Housing Units
Amendatory Language
For the reasons stated in the preamble, we amend 36 CFR part 1191 as follows:
Adding new section 233.3.1.2.2 to read as follows:
233.3.1.2.2 Group Sites. Where group sites are developed for the installation of emergency transportable housing units, entities shall comply with 233.3.1.2.2.
Adding new section F233.4.1.2.2 to read as follows:
F233.4.1.2.2 Group Sites. Where group sites are developed for the installation of emergency transportable housing units, entities shall comply with F233.3.1.2.2.
Amendatory Language
For the reasons stated in the preamble, we amend 36 CFR part 1191 as follows:
Adding new section 233.3.1.2.2.1 to read as follows:
233.3.1.2.2.1 Unit Pads. At least 10 percent, but no fewer than one, of the unit pads prepared for the installation of emergency transportable housing units at each group site shall be designed and constructed to accept the installation of emergency transportable housing units with mobility features complying with 809.2 and shall be on an accessible route as required by 206.
Adding new section F233.4.1.2.2.1 to read as follows:
F233.4.1.2.2.1 Unit Pads. At least 10 percent, but no fewer than one, of the unit pads prepared for the installation of emergency transportable housing units at each group site shall be designed and constructed to accept the installation of emergency transportable housing units with mobility features complying with 809.2 and shall be on an accessible route as required by F206.
Amendatory Language
For the reasons stated in the preamble, we amend 36 CFR part 1191 as follows:
Adding new sections 233.3.1.2.2.2 to read as follows:
233.3.1.2.2.2 Units Installed. At least 5 percent, but no fewer than one, of the total number of the emergency transportable housing units installed at each group site shall provide mobility features complying with 809.2.
Adding new sections F233.4.1.2.2.2 to read as follows:
F233.4.1.2.2.2 Units Installed. At least 5 percent, but no fewer than one, of the total number of the emergency transportable housing units installed at each group site shall provide mobility features complying with 809.2.
